What is the main function of the nucleolus?

a. it produces cell adhesion proteins that are then exported to the cell membrane.
b. it is the site of photosynthesis in photosynthetic cells.
c. its function is not yet known.
d. it produces enzymes that are then exported to the lysosomes.
e. it is the site of ribosome-subunit synthesis?

1 Answer

3 votes
E: It is the site of ribosome-subnit synthesis.
